Ryan Fox Wins Myrtle Beach Classic in Playoff
Ryan Fox of New Zealand won his first PGA Tour title at the Myrtle Beach Classic by chipping in from about 50 feet for birdie on the first playoff hole, defeating Mackenzie Hughes and Harry Higgs. Fox shot a final-round 66 to reach a three-way tie at 15-under-par, with the playoff forced after Hughes bogeyed the 18th. The victory not only earned Fox his maiden PGA Tour title but also secured him the last spot in the upcoming PGA Championship at Quail Hollow. Fox celebrated with his family and discussed the challenges of adjusting to life on the PGA Tour, expressing optimism for his season ahead. The win makes Fox the first New Zealander to claim a PGA Tour event since 2015 and grants him entry into The Memorial Tournament, The Sentry, and The Players Championship. Both Higgs and Hughes praised the playoff and acknowledged the special nature of Fox's victory.
